Facilities Ticket — Cleaning Crew Access, Brindle Annex

For new starters handling evening lock-up: the Sorano Cleaning crew arrives nightly at 21:30 via the annex side door. Check their rota sheet, note arrival in the log, and ensure the storeroom is relocked afterward. To let them through the side door, enter the access code below.

badge for yaweg-hafog: bdg-GX-6

## Deployment

ReceiptWren, our donation-receipt mailer, deploys from the `stable` branch via the Quillgate pipeline. Before promoting a build, confirm the template bundle version matches what the Harbrook finance team signed off on, since receipts are legally sensitive. Run the dry-run mailer against the sandbox donor list and inspect at least three rendered PDFs. Rollbacks must restore both the binary and the template bundle together; mismatched pairs produce blank totals. The environment expects the following configuration values at startup.

settings of tawif-tafog:
[oliox]
port = 7000
team = pelius
host = oliox.plorvaforge.corp
region = upper-2
access_code = ac_48b9f0
timeout_ms = 3000

This alert fires when the Verdantine controller detects that a humidity or temperature probe has diverged more than 5% from the rolling median of its peer sensors over a six-hour window. Drift is usually caused by condensation on probe housings or aging calibration, not controller faults. Before acknowledging, check the Cropline dashboard for the affected bay and confirm whether a recalibration job is already queued. If drift persists after recalibration, escalate to the hardware team at the address below.

pager mailbox: silael.sorwyn.tamius@zemvarsys.corp

Step 4 — Catalogue import (Shelfwright)

New hires: run this after the schema migration, never before. Pull the latest Ashgate Library export into /srv/imports and confirm the row count matches the manifest. Set CATALOGUE_SOURCE=ashgate and IMPORT_BATCH_SIZE=500 in the deploy env file. Do not raise the batch size; the MARC parser chokes above 500. The importer authenticates against the catalogue gateway, so the env file needs its access secret before you run anything. Append that credential line now.

sealed setting: ARCHIVE_KEY3=8d0